Tournament Time: 3 Big Reds and One Hornet Bound for The Palace

The state wrestling tournament begins Thursday.

There will be three Big Reds and one Hornet at the MHSAA state wrestling finals taking place at The Palace of Auburn Hills Thursday-Saturday.

Saline’s Adam Bruley, 39-15, will wrestle in the 112-pound weight class in Division 1.

Milan has three wrestlers in the Division 2 tournament, including Tim Sims, the senior with a 55-0 record. Sims, ranked third in his divisional weight class by Michigangrappler.com, is wrestling at 152 pounds. Matt Schultz, 47-8, managed to qualify for the finals despite going to regionals as a low seed. Schultz is wrestling at 215 pounds. Dillon Farrell, 20-5, is the third Big Red at The Palace. He bounced back from an injury-riddled start of the season and made it through districts and regionals. He’s wrestling at 145 pounds.
